14 Dec.
Rio Laja vicinity, Chis. to 7mi N Tapanatepec, cap.
Up about 7:30 and on the road by 10 after Sam hunted
birds and we did some skeletons. Bought more food in
Tuxtla then brunch at Restaurante "La Selva" - a fine
place. On the road by 11:30 headed for Rizo de Oro.
Passed Baker's 42km W Cuntalopa locality but this
is now in very bad shape (agriculture) that we won't
collect here. Went out the road to Colonia Figueroa
at Rizo de Oro for 2 1/2 mi to a stream Ted Papenfuss
had suggested but, while there was some water
in it, it was far too open & dry away from the river
to be worth anything. This road is terrible. Decided
to net again 7mi N Tapanatepec and arrived
there at 3:30. Will call this 7.3 km NE junct 180-20
(or 190), Oaxaca. I processed bats until 6:30.
Sam set nets (3) about 1/4 mi upstream where
a small tributary enters for the R (walking upstream).
Caught the Trachops (right above the water) & Centurio
in this net. Nets down by 9:00 as activity
light. Saw many Pteronotus davyi (?)
